Aluminum Matched with Steel Hood

Determining the right material for a car bonnet is critical, as it influences both functionality and aesthetics. Aluminum and steel are two popular choices, each with distinct advantages. Aluminum is featherweight, boosting fuel efficiency and agility; it also resists corrosion, which can lengthen the bonnet's lifespan. However, aluminum can be more expensive and may not offer the same level of impact resistance as steel. On the other hand, steel provides greater durability and strength, making it less prone to dents and damage. It is typically more budget-friendly but can be heavier, detailed article potentially affecting performance. Ultimately, the decision between aluminum and steel will depend on the specific needs and priorities of the vehicle owner, balancing cost, weight, and durability considerations.

Composite Material Advantages

Composite materials continue to increase popularity in the automotive industry for car bonnets because of their unique blend of lightweight features and exceptional strength. These materials, typically including carbon fiber or fiberglass, deliver heightened durability while resisting corrosion and environmental damage. They are designed to absorb impact, providing superior protection against dents and dings. Moreover, composites can be shaped into complex configurations, allowing for innovative designs that boost aerodynamics and aesthetics. This versatility also helps manufacturers develop bonnets that align with modern vehicle styling. Additionally, producing composite materials may be more environmentally friendly, aiding sustainability efforts within the automotive sector. Overall, composite materials provide a persuasive choice for enhancing vehicle performance and longevity.

Tips for Caring for a Long-Lasting Car Bonnet

Careful maintenance of a car bonnet ensures durability and maintains the vehicle's aesthetic. Frequent cleaning is vital; using a gentle detergent and soft cloth assists in eliminating dirt and grime that can lead to corrosion. Coating the bonnet every few months provides an extra layer of defense against UV rays and external pollutants.

Assessing the bonnet for scratches and dents is crucial. Immediately handling any damage with paint application prevents rust onset. Also, inspecting the alignment and copyrights confirms unobstructed operation and prevents future difficulties.

For those residing in severe weather conditions, applying a protective coating can improve durability. Leaving your vehicle in covered spots or applying a car cover when not in use can also minimize exposure to harmful elements.
